Ronald W. Stout, MD, MPH,
FACPM
Midwest Regent
Dr
Stout currently serves as a Medical Director for Procter &
Gamble’s Global Health and Wellbeing Business Unit.
Procter and Gambles health care business’s include
pharmaceutical, Oral Care, OTC, diagnostic, MDVIP
(prevention based primary care) and Pet health. At
Procter & Gamble, Dr Stout areas of responsibility include
occupational medicine, pharmicovigilance (Safety
Surveillance) and Medical Affairs.
Dr
Stout formerly was the Medical Director for Preventive
Medicine and Occupational Services at Kettering Medical
Center. Previously he served the United States Air Force
in a number of roles including: IMA, Office of the Air
Force Surgeon General, Occupational and Environmental
Medicine Consultant, Senior Preventive Medicine Consultant
and a Principal Investigator, Air Force Health Study.
Dr
Stout has served ACPM on the Corporate Council, program
planning committees, the Strategic Planning Taskforce, as
Chair of the Young Physicians Section and AMA Young
Physicians Section Delegate. In addition to his service
on the ACPM Board, Dr Stout currently serves as a Trustee
of the American Board of Preventive Medicine, on the AMA
Preventive Medicine Section Council and on the Board of
Editors, Chemical Health & Safety.
Dr
Stout received his B.S. from Andrews University, his M.D.
from Loma Linda University and his Family Practice
training at Hinsdale Hospital in Chicago, where he was
chief resident. He earned an MPH from The Johns Hopkins
University, School of Hygiene and Public Health and an
MPH-HA from Benedictine University. He is Board Certified
in Family Practice, General Preventive Medicine and Public
Health and Occupational Medicine.
